Output ec6449dbb49bd14db660bae40681ab27c36fdf837fa10cef6b09c76603169767:6

value
4332692
script pubkey
OP_0 OP_PUSHBYTES_20 67043523aa178a8c7ec30d3ca44543374d0b2bef
address
bc1qvuzr2ga2z79gclkrp572g32rxaxsk2l0yj7520
transaction
ec6449dbb49bd14db660bae40681ab27c36fdf837fa10cef6b09c76603169767
spent
true